# Founder Productivity

Time audits, energy management, deep work scheduling, and priority frameworks for founders who wear too many hats.

## Purpose

Founders don't need generic productivity advice. They need to ruthlessly prioritize the 20% of work that drives 80% of results, while managing energy across shifting roles.

## Workflow

### Step 1: Time Audit
Ask the user to list how they spent time last week, or reconstruct from calendar. Categorize:
- **$10/hr work:** Admin, data entry, scheduling, formatting
- **$100/hr work:** Managing, coordinating, sales calls
- **$1,000/hr work:** Strategy, key relationships, product decisions
- **$10,000/hr work:** Vision, fundraising, partnerships, culture

Most founders spend 70%+ on $10-$100/hr work.

### Step 2: Energy Mapping
- When is your peak energy? (morning, afternoon, evening)
- What activities give you energy?
- What activities drain you?
- How many hours of deep work can you sustain daily?

Match highest-value work to peak energy hours.

### Step 3: Priority Framework
Use the ICE framework:
- **Impact:** How much will this move the needle? (1-10)
- **Confidence:** How sure am I this will work? (1-10)
- **Ease:** How easy is this to do? (1-10)
- Score = Impact x Confidence x Ease

Rank all current priorities.

### Step 4: Ideal Week Design
Create a weekly template:
- Deep work blocks (2-4 hour morning blocks, no meetings)
- Meeting batching (group calls into 1-2 days)
- Admin time (batched, not scattered)
- Buffer time (you'll need it)
- Weekly review and planning

### Step 5: System Recommendations
Based on the audit:
- What to stop doing entirely
- What to delegate (link to delegation-framework skill)
- What to automate (link to automation-workflows skill)
- What to batch
- What to protect (deep work time)

## Constraints
- Don't prescribe a system — adapt to how the founder already works
- Acknowledge that startup life is chaotic — the ideal week is aspirational, not rigid
- Focus on the biggest 1-2 changes, not a complete overhaul
- Don't guilt-trip about how time is currently spent
